Subject: Key rotation for the Tilevault cache layer

Hello support team,

As part of our quarterly security cycle, the credential used by internal tools to query the Tilevault tile-rendering cache will be rotated this Thursday. After the rotation, any saved diagnostic scripts using the old key will receive authorization errors, so please update them before end of day Friday. Cached tiles themselves are unaffected. The replacement key for Tilevault is included below.

service key, fawip-bajef: kto11_Qt5wZK9vdNC

## Add watchdog to Perchpoint kiosk app

Hey — this PR gives the kiosk a proper watchdog instead of hoping the UI thread never wedges. A background timer now pings the main loop; if it misses enough heartbeats in a row, we log a crash bundle and restart the app cleanly. There's also a cooldown so a flapping kiosk doesn't restart-loop forever. Tune carefully — too aggressive and you'll reboot kiosks mid-transaction. Current settings are shown below.

tuning constants:
QUOTAS = {
    "druwyn": 5,
    "holix": 5,
    "zorath": 5,
    "holwyn": 10,
}

For the incoming director: this page summarizes the proposed training allocation for next year at Hollowgate Instruments. The draft envelope covers certification renewals for the Tarnley plant, a leadership cohort run through our internal Brightstep program, and a modest pool for conference travel. Allocations were built bottom-up from team submissions, then trimmed 6% to match the finance guidance issued in October. Departmental splits are still provisional. Before approving any line items, review the confidential note directly below.

internal memo for baduf-fafop: Normirix Works is in early talks to buy Ulaoxox Partners for about $497.5 million. The Wenael launch date is October 14, and nothing goes to the press before then. Legal wants the Nordorax Logistics term sheet countersigned before September 22.